F1 power units will undergo a major overhaul from 2026, but over the years the sport’s engines have already been through a ...
Formula 1's power unit manufacturers and its governing body the FIA are set for the next round of talks on the series' next engine formula. F1 is moving to new power units in 2026 with a near 50/50 ...
It was on the morning of the glitzy season launch at London’s O2 Arena in February when Formula 1 lost its collective head. There, it’s said, during an F1 Commission meeting, Christian Horner – Red ...
You're here because you find automotive technical minutiae fascinating. While there's plenty of cool engines in passenger cars — oddities like the Honda S800's roller bearing crank that needs no oil ...
Scuderia Ferrari was founded by Enzo Ferrari in 1929 and is the only team to compete in every season since since Formula 1 was established in 1950. Ferrari isn't just the oldest team in F1, it's also ...
Even if you're a complete stranger to motorsport, a quick glimpse at the world of F1 reveals that it isn't a cheap endeavor. A field of teams, armed with mechanics, strategists, and PR managers fly ...